Your seats are categorized based on your purchased ticket. Budget seating generally places you in the upper decks, often on the short side of the rink behind the goal. While these seats are higher, they still offer a good vantage point with a broad perspective of the game. Regular seats tend to be in the upper and middle tiers on the longer side of the rink, providing a more comprehensive view of the ice.
Premium seats are located in the inner ring, in the lower tiers closest to the ice. These offer an immersive experience where you can really see the skill and speed of NHL players, making every pass, shot, and save more visceral.

Are the tickets sent via email or mobile?
Your tickets will be sent as a mobile ticket directly to your smartphone, making entry quick and easy.
Can I choose my seat category?
Yes, seats are assigned based on the category you select. Budget seats are usually in the upper decks, while premium seats are closer to the ice.
What is included in the ticket price?
The ticket includes entry to the game and your assigned seat. It does not include hotel transportation, food, or drinks.
Are there any restrictions on what I can bring into the arena?
Yes, large bags, luggage, weapons, and sharp objects are not allowed inside the arena.
How long does the game typically last?
The game duration is approximately 2.5 hours, usually scheduled for the afternoon or evening.
Is this suitable for families or children?
Yes, but keep in mind the arena can get quite loud and crowded. Consider seating options and noise levels if bringing young children.
